A bank offers an APR of 6.2% compounded daily .<br><br>the annual percentage yeild is ___% ?
Pani-rosa [81]
The annual yield is

                 (1 + 0.062/365)³⁶⁵  =  1.06396

The percentage yield is therefore   6.396% .

An antique dealer has 24 clock radios to sell at 12 a 12 hour long antique Radio sale use the graph to complete the table why is
Lerok [7]

Answer:

R = -H + 24

Step-by-step explanation:

An antique dealer has 24 clock radios to sell 12 at  a 12 hour long antique Radio sale

12 radios are sold in 12 Hour

Table

Hours                Radio Available Remaining

0                        24

2                        22

4                        20

6                        18

8                        16

10                       14

12                        12

Line of equation R = mH + c

R = Radios Available / Remaining to be sold

H = Hours of Sale passed

m = slope of line

c = constant

H = 0  ,  R = 24

24 = 0 + c

=> c = 24

R = mH + 24

for H =2 R = 22

22 = 2m + 24

=> m = -1

R = -H + 24

As every passing hour he will be able to sell a radio so number of radios available will keep decreasing so there is a sign of - multiplied by H

24 is the radio available at beginning of sale.

if we plot a graph for Radio sold against hours

then equation would be

R = H     ( c = 0 as no radio sold at beginning of sale)
